        Lazuli is a pip-compatible, Python-based package for interacting with [AzureMSv316](https://github.com/SoulGirlJP/AzureV316)-based databases.  
        Lazuli is inspired by and based on the [SwordieDB](https://github.com/Bratah123/SwordieDB) project.  
        
        Lazuli allows access to character and inventory attributes in [AzureMSv316](https://github.com/SoulGirlJP/AzureV316)-based databases.  
        This makes it possible to produce not only feature-rich Discord bots, but also integrated websites.

        ### Quick Start
        Installation via PyPi/Pip:
          1. Run `pip install lazuli` inside of your venv (or global, if desired)
              - see [wiki](https://github.com/TEAM-SPIRIT-Productions/Lazuli/wiki/Technical-Details) for how to generate venv
          2. Import the module in your project
              - `from lazuli.database import Lazuli`
          3. Create an Azure database object using the Lazuli class constructor
              - `azure = Lazuli()`
              - See the [Wiki](https://github.com/TEAM-SPIRIT-Productions/Lazuli/wiki/Sample-Code-Fragments#loading-a-database) for full examples
              - See the [API Docs](https://team-spirit-productions.github.io/Lazuli/reference/lazuli/) for more in-depth technical documentation
          4. Query
              - E.g. `number_of_players_online = azure.get_online_count()`
                - gives number (int) of accounts currently connected to the server
